It was my very first time visiting the Puchong Setia Walk and my very first destination of the day was Chilla Cup. From what I was being told, Chilla Cup is everybody’s feel good experience whereby it will always bring you back to your mum’s kitchen with fresh coffee brewing on the stove and just-made pretzels baking in the oven. They have a pretty wide selections of coffee and smoothies that are accompanied by variety of food. So let's take a look at the food and drinks that are being offered by Chilla Cup.Fish & Chips RM16.90Just like the usual fish and chips that we have, this particular one is quite good. The deep fried fish was not too oily and goes very well with the pinch of squeezed lemon and tartar sauce.Chicken BurgerThis Chicken Burger is not those typical chicken burger that we had in McDonald. It uses grilled chicken thigh instead of those mixed chicken meat which is made into patty. Comes with fries and salad on the side.Dory fish with sour cream spaghetti RM16.90One of my favorite, the Dory Fish with Sour Cream Spaghetti is tasty and creamy. I just can't stop having this and I will make sure to order this again on my next visit to Chilla Cup.Caramel Butter Thick Toast RM8.50Seafood Spaghetti RM14.90Their Seafood Spaghetti consist of prawns, mussel, fish and squid which is full of flavour and the portion is not bad for a person who is hungry and wanted a filling meal.It's very cozy and comfortable. I won't mind to spend my day here with to go online with my laptop and have a cup of coffee! continue reading

They serve good selection of food like the freshly baked signatures pretzels, thick toasts and tortilla, pasta, western and Asian delights, soup and salads, sandwiches and burgers. They also serve coffee, tea and juice. The food costs from RM 5 to RM 20. Here are some of the items on the menu with price. The soup of the day when we visited was minestrone soup. In Chilla Cup, do expect the top-up soup to be at the generous portion that is somewhat we believe the portion you will get at full price. The soup was very thick with plenty of vegetables and pasta. It tasted flavourful and sour but appetizing. Your stomach might be filled full with just the soup if you are a small eater, but it is very satisfying. Al-fungi tortilla, Hawaiian tortilla and Nasi Goreng Kampung with Honey Paprika Chicken were the main course we ordered. At the price of RM 9.90, the nasi goreng kampong set comes with a piece of honey paprika chicken and a drink, The nasi goreng is tasty! The Al-fungi tortilla set and the ala-carte Hawaiian tortilla was about RM 13 – RM 15. Feeling expensive? Not at all! After trying the first bite, it was totally value for money! The tortilla was cheesy, crispy and full of toppings. See it for yourself here... Don't forget to always seal your meal with a nice cup of coffee. They do brew good coffee, so don’t forget to try it out when you are there. continue reading
